Summary
The STARLINK-4278 satellite, also known as Starlink 4278, is a communication spacecraft operated by SPXS (SpaceX) and part of the Starlink constellation. Launched on July 17, 2022, from Cape Canaveral Air Force Station's Launch Complex 40 using a Falcon 9 launch vehicle, it has dimensions including a length of 0.2 meters, diameter of 2.8 meters, and span of 9 meters. The satellite weighs 297 kilograms at launch and carries a dry mass of 275 kilograms. It is equipped with Ku/Ka-band payload capabilities along with an optical inter-satellite link for data transmission. Power is provided by solar arrays and batteries, while its propulsion system uses krypton ion thrusters for maneuvering. The satellite's shape can be described as box-like with a pan configuration.

Starlink is a satellite constellation developed by SpaceX with the aim of providing global broadband internet coverage. Thousands of small satellites are deployed in low Earth orbit (LEO), enabling high-speed internet access even in remote areas. However, the rapid increase in satellites raises concerns about space debris and the potential for collisions, which can lead to further debris creation and endanger other spacecraft. Additionally, the sheer number of Starlink satellites can affect astronomical observations by increasing light pollution. Proper deorbiting plans and international coordination are essential to mitigate these challenges and ensure long-term sustainability in space.
